冗余系统硬件配置为:两个CPU315-2DP,MPI连接用于冗余数据交换,IM153-2一对,CPU上集成的DP口分别连接IM152-2的DP口构成冗余系统。IM153-2上挂接一个DI模块、一个DO模块、一个CP341模块(用于和CPU226XM的自由口模式通讯)。
现在的问题是
一:在FC100中定义DB_NO、DB_NO_LEN 、DB_A_B_NO 、 DB_A_B_NO_LEN 、 DB_B_A_NO、 DB_B_A_NO_LEN后CPU就出现错误,而当长度定义为0时主从连接正常,错误如下:
Event 1 of 100: Event ID 16# 4541
STOP caused by priority class system
Event: Cycle time exceeded
OB number: 132
Priority class: 26
Previous operating mode: RUN
Requested operating mode: STOP (internal)
Internal error, Incoming event
01:12:10:726 pm 06/10/04
Event 2 of 100: Event ID 16# 2522
Area length error when reading
Global DB, double-word access, Access address: 4382
Requested OB: Programming error OB (OB121)
Priority class: 1
Internal error, Incoming event
01:12:10:725 pm 06/10/04
非常感谢您的指点!